			<content:encoded><![CDATA[<p style="text-align: left;">Last Friday <a href="http://www.fleck.com" target="_blank">Fleck</a> got launched at a big Techcrunch party in New-york. Fleck is a all new web-application to annotate webpages. Or according to the Fleck website: Fleck wants to add a new layer of interactivity to the web.</p>
<p><img title="Fleck logo" src="http://www.wietseveenstra.nl/images/fleck_logo.gif" alt="Fleck logo" align="middle" /></p>
<p>Fleck is a free service which allows people to add a note to a website. At first you can only view your own notes but in a later version it might become possible to share notes with groups. Fleck comes as a plugin for Firefox. Opera supports Fleck without installing a plugin and the plugin for Internet Explorer will be available soon. There is also a Wordpress plugin that allows viewers to annotate your blog posts, which from now is also possible at my weblog:) (click on &#8216;annotate this page&#8217; below this post for an example).  Fleck is not a new idea. In the 90s there have been serveral projects trying to launch the same kind of service but they all died a quick dead. There are also services with the same functionality online now, like <a href="http://www.trailfire.com" target="_blank">Trailfire</a>. Personally I think Fleck is great and I think this will become big.</p>
